



Cala Deià
Cala Deià, Spain
Cala Deià is a picturesque cove on the northwest coast of Mallorca, renowned for its crystal-clear turquoise waters and stunning rock pools, offering a tranquil escape for nature lovers and those seeking a serene beach experience.
What Makes It Special
- The cove is surrounded by dramatic cliffs and lush greenery, providing a breathtaking backdrop that enhances the natural beauty of the area.
- Unlike many beaches in Mallorca, Cala Deià features no sandy stretches, making it perfect for those who enjoy swimming and exploring the rocky coastline.
- The area is popular among local artists and photographers, drawn by its stunning scenery and unique light, making it a great spot for capturing memorable images.
Insider Tips
- Visit early in the morning or later in the afternoon to avoid the crowds and enjoy a more peaceful atmosphere.
- Bring water shoes for better footing on the rocky surfaces, as the cove's natural terrain can be uneven and slippery.
- Consider packing a picnic, as there are limited facilities nearby, and enjoying a meal with a view of the stunning waters is a memorable experience.
